The Terminator franchise has featured a diverse range of actors over the years, from Oscar-winners to Razzie contenders, but almost every major performer in the series has had at least one outrageously bad dud that they'd no doubt prefer fans would just forget about. The only significant exception is Emilia Clarke, because her lowest-reviewed movie is actually Terminator Genisys itself. From straight-to-video sequels that indicate a career spiraling downwards, to misguided dramas, blatant paycheck roles, and the early movies that broke these actors into the business, each of these films were destroyed by critics (and most also made no money), such that they're nothing short of an embarrassment to look back on now. While the likes of Christian Bale may well want to forget Terminator Salvation itself (and if Genisys doesn't get a sequel, its cast may want to do the same), the focus here is on movies outside of the iconic franchise, no matter how tawdry the last two films have been. Almost every actor has had a bad career choice or blatantly taken a part for the money (unless you're the late John Cazale, of course), but most of the time, they're not quite a trainwreck of this magnitude.
